The long-lasting Champs Elysees avenue in central Paris has been cleared by the riot police in lower than an hour amid clashes with followers
Paris has seen some intense clashes between the police and soccer followers on Sunday evening because the French nationwide group suffered a defeat to Argentina on the World Cup in Qatar. Cops in riot gear have been deployed to disperse the crowds nonetheless occupying the enduring Champs Elysees avenue in central Paris after the ultimate match.
“In such a state of affairs, solely those that have come to struggle … stay,” a police supply informed Le Parisien. Pictures and movies revealed on social media confirmed giant teams of law enforcement officials carrying riot gear chasing the followers down the Champs Elysees whereas kicking them and bashing them with the shields.
Followers are seen combating again and throwing fireworks on the officers on among the movies. Most movies solely present the gang operating away from the legislation enforcement officers, although. One of many movies additionally confirmed a person mendacity on the bottom and surrounded by law enforcement officials. In keeping with Le Parisien, the police charged a small crowd of followers that have been throwing bottles and fireworks and managed to shortly disperse them.
An hour after the top of the match, the police arrested some ten folks over the possession of fireworks, Le Parisien reported. There have been no experiences about accidents or property injury, though some folks on social media spoke of “riots” in Paris within the wake of the ultimate sport.

The police deployed over 2,700 officers to Paris alone forward of the sport in anticipation of potential unrest, in response to the French media. The French capital in addition to the nation’s different cities have seen outbreaks of violence following France’s World Cup semifinal victory over Morocco final week.
